EPIDERM

Ep"i*derm, n. Etym: [Cf. F. épiderme. See Epidermis.] (Anat.)

Definition: The epidermis.

Coffee Trivia

Decaffeinated coffee is not caffeine-free. Studies from the National Institute of Health (US) have shown that virtually all decaf coffee types contain caffeine. A 236-ml (8-oz) cup of decaf coffee contains up to 7 mg of caffeine, whereas a regular cup provided 70-140 mg.
